Nov 1, 2021 · Put options. Put options have a negative Delta that can range from 0.00 to –1.00. At-the-money options usually have a Delta near –0.50. The Delta will decrease (and approach –1.00) as the option gets deeper ITM. The Delta of ITM put options will get closer to –1.00 as expiration approaches. The contract value of Crude oil is – 3221 * 100 = Rs.3,22,100/-The contract value of Crude oil mini is 3217 * 10 = Rs.32,170/-Given this, one should buy 10 lots of Crude oil mini at 3217 and sell 1 lot of crude oil at 3221. By doing so, the contract sizes are similar, and therefore the arbitrage holds.Basis = Futures price - Spot price = ₹2,505 - ₹2,500 = ₹5. Here, spot price is less than futures price i.e. futures price > spot price. As RIL futures are trading higher than the RIL spot, the RIL futures are said to be trading at “contango". Investors who utilize these online tools have the advantage of using clear data to guide their decisions, effectively increasing their likelihood of investing in stocks that’ll potentially ...Select Product Type: Futures or Options; Select Symbol: This is a variable field depending on your choice of contract (e.g.: NIFTY, BANKNIFTY or any stock) ...Option contracts fall into two categories, call options and put options. A call option is the right to “buy” the underlying product at a predetermined price. A put option is the right to “sell” the underlying product at a predetermined price.
